Position Summary We are looking for an experienced IT Support Specialist to manage and support our IT systems across two office locations. The ideal candidate will have a strong technical background, excellent problem-solving skills, and the 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ams. If you are passionate about technology and enjoy contributing to the success of a rapidly growing organization, we invite you to apply. Responsibilities: • Protect our business from cybersecurity threats by running regular security checks • Implement new technology, such as desktops and computer hardware, operating systems, software programs, and applications • Administer new user accounts, work email addresses, and access levels to new employees to ensure they have everything they need to work efficiently • Troubleshoot technological issues and solve problems quickly to ensure our business operations run smoothly • Ensure our computers are backed up so all files are saved in case the system crashes • Maintain technological equipment, including phones, printers, computers, operating systems, network systems, hardware etc. • Provide technical support to employees, addressing hardware and software issues promptly • Collaborate with external vendors for additional technical support when needed • Conduct regular updates and upgrades to ensure systems are current and secure • Educate employees on IT policies and best practices • Work closely with various departments to understand IT needs and implement solutions that enhance productivity • Conduct training sessions to educate employees on IT tools and systems • Manage an inventory of IT assets, tracking equipment and software licenses • Understand how to use workflow automation software such as Zapier Qualifications: • At least two years experience in a professional IT work environment • Has worked with a variety of operating systems, including Windows, Mac, and Linux systems • Solid understanding of troubleshooting Internet connectivity, network systems, phone systems, and other technological equipment in the office • Strong communication skills, organizational skills, and time management skills • Slack experience a Plus • Must be proficient in the Apple ecosystem or at least understand basic Apple products like phones and laptops Compensation: $25 - $30 hourly
